If you're planning to put in a cat flap on your uPVC door, it's best to hire an expert. The person who will do the job will mark the location of the pet-door on your front or wall, and then drill around all corners. The tasker can also use a Jigsaw to cut the flap's outline, ensuring that it is sized to fit the door. Once the frame is complete, the Tasker will put in the door mount on the outside and screws, then put the frame inside the interior (the side that has the flap) and screw it in the appropriate position. They will also apply caulk to prevent leaks and loss of energy.

It's important that you encourage your pets to utilize the cat flap once it's installed. Start by offering a treat to reward them for passing through the doorway, and then slowly increase their exposure. Keep in mind that some pets and cats may require extra encouragement to get used to the door for pets, so be patient! You could even invite a family member to stand on the outside of the door to demonstrate how to get through the flap.

Depending on the type of cat Flap glass door installation near me [http://bmwportal.lv/user/souparmy82/]-door you choose It may be necessary to set it up within your double glazing. This is usually a specialist job that requires a skilled professional to cut a small to medium flap space into the double glazing. In the average, it costs between PS150 between PS150 and PS220.
If you have an exterior door that is double-glazed you might want to consider getting a Tasker to do the installation. You should get an estimate prior to any work, so that you know what to expect. They will need to measure the door frame, then order a new piece of glass (either one or two panes) with a precision cut-out for the pet flap and install it. This will guarantee a high-quality finish and the highest energy savings.
